    Shark Rocket HV320UKT True Pet

    Have just recently invested in this and it's totally brilliant for cat hair, it's made our carpets like new!

    Quite lightweight and can be used as an upright, a stick or a handheld.

    It's got a separate motorised brush for pet hair which is incredibly effective.

    Not the cheapest at £200 and its not the quietest but worth every penny.

    I used to have a Miele Cat and Dog then I tried a cylinder Sebo. Terrific suction but it was heavier and noisier than the Miele. Plus it threw out a lot of heat and the hose was thick and awkward when it came to storing. Gone back to Miele.
